It aims to improve both their communication and comprehension skills in order for them to become proficient users of the English language.

This course offers extensive instruction and practice in the four skills: speaking, reading, writing and listening. It provides a solid curriculum which covers all aspects of grammar, builds vocabulary, practises pronunciation and gives students a well-balanced variety of exercises and activities. Furthermore, learners will be expected to speak English at all times, thus consolidating their speaking and listening skills. All course books are accompanied by an audio cassette and the teacher makes use of a workbook which provides further exercises and activities to supplement the course

The course takes students from Beginner level to Advanced, and is divided into six different levels. Each level has its own course book.

Beginner
This course is designed for those students who have a very limited knowledge of English. It covers basic grammar and vocabulary that will enable the students to begin effectively learning the four language skills – reading, writing, listening and speaking. At the end of this course, students will have a sound platform on which to develop their study of English.

Elementary
This course introduces the English tense system in a more developed way than at the beginner level. It expands present, past and future tenses, develops vocabulary and covers parts of speech (e.g. nouns, verbs, adjectives, prepositions, etc.) It also provides extensive practice in the four skills. On completion of this course, students will be familiar with the fundamental structures of the English language.

Pre-intermediate
This course revises and expands upon language learned in the Elementary course as well as introducing some more complicated structures and functions. On completing this course, students will be effective, though not perfect communicators in English, and will have developed a good level of confidence in their ability.

Intermediate
At this level, the focus is on function and the use of English. All grammar structures will be revised but the emphasis will be on the correct uses of these structures. On completion of this course, students will be effective communicators able to manage complex sentences, using an extensive range of vocabulary.

Upper Intermediate
At this level, students are introduced to subtleties of English such as idioms, literary English and connotation. The tense system is revised and different functions of structures, such as modals and conditionals, are fully examined. On completion of this course, students will have a high level of fluency, and will be capable of employing and understanding different uses of English depending on purpose and situation.

Advanced
Having reached this level, students will have already been introduced to, revised and extensively practised all areas of the English language. The focus here is on perfecting their knowledge and increasing their understanding of the finer points of appropriacy and usage. On completing this course, the students will be capable of communicating and understanding English in all situations.
